Latest Patents

Eckert's latest patents include an X-ray sensitive camera that comprises two image receivers. This invention features a first X-ray-sensitive image detector that creates a first tomographic image with a specific depth of focus profile. Additionally, it includes a second X-ray-sensitive image detector for generating a second tomographic image with a smaller depth of focus profile. The design allows for the adjustment of either image detector to align with an X-ray emitter, facilitating the creation of precise X-ray images. The second image detector is notably larger in one dimension and smaller in another, optimizing the imaging process.

Another patent focuses on an X-ray device that integrates an image receiver within an X-ray sensitive camera. This device includes an X-ray emitter and various adjusting means for the image receiver and emitter, enhancing the overall functionality and efficiency of X-ray imaging.
